Transaction fa08a801a96919fb895db51c7d57a88eb747395913d7be4629e8a2ea48e5732a
2 Input
2 Outputs
- fa08a801a96919fb895db51c7d57a88eb747395913d7be4629e8a2ea48e5732a:0
- fa08a801a96919fb895db51c7d57a88eb747395913d7be4629e8a2ea48e5732a:1
value 95923
address 1DNaekZsKczPYS454w2KVx5aQ68ay5vzDs
value 373646
address 3DSMqqmHsc9Gmw3LLsgXeLTuMC6mUkhwy7